Preparing Your Deck for Discoloration



To make sure a durable and effective deck discoloration job, detailed preparation of the deck surface is necessary. Begin by cleaning up the deck completely to get rid of dirt, gunk, mildew, and any old tarnish or complete.


Examine the deck for any type of harmed or rotten boards that need to be replaced. Hammer down any type of protruding nails and sand any kind of rough areas to guarantee a smooth surface for staining. Inspect for any kind of loose barriers or actions that might require tightening or repair work.




When the deck is tidy, dry, and in great repair service, take into consideration using a timber brightener to recover the deck's natural color and open the timber pores for far better tarnish penetration. Lastly, secure any kind of nearby plants, furnishings, or surface areas with plastic sheet before continuing with the discoloration procedure. Using Stain With Different Methods



For a expert and perfect coating, the technique of using stain plays a vital role Recommended Reading in enhancing the appearance and durability of your deck. There are numerous strategies you can use to make sure a reliable application of tarnish.


Cleaning is a typical technique that permits precision and control over the quantity of stain applied. It is excellent for complex areas and reaching between deck boards (Stain Deck). Rolling is a quicker option, covering bigger surface areas efficiently. Nevertheless, back-brushing after rolling is advised to level the tarnish and function it right into the wood for far better infiltration.


Spraying is another prominent technique, supplying rate and convenience of application, specifically for huge deck areas. It is necessary to use a premium sprayer and be conscious of overspray. Pad applicators give a smooth and even complete and appropriate for both vertical and straight surfaces. Keeping and Re-staining Your Deck



Correct upkeep and prompt re-staining are necessary for preserving the appeal and longevity of your deck. Regular maintenance tasks include sweeping debris, cleaning up with a deck cleaner, and evaluating for any kind check my site of indicators of wear or damage. Dealing with problems without delay can prevent extra substantial problems in the future. When it concerns re-staining your deck, the frequency depends on numerous factors such as the kind of stain utilized, the environment in your area, and exactly how much wear and tear your deck experiences. Generally, it is suggested to re-stain your deck every 2-4 years to keep its security and looks.


Prior to re-staining, make sure the deck is clean, dry, and without any type of previous stain deposit. Fining sand might be necessary to smooth out harsh locations or eliminate old tarnish that is flaking. Choose a high-grade discolor that suits your deck's product and offers the wanted degree of defense.
